Probably not: Metformin is used to treat diabetes. Years ago it was found to be associated with restoring menstrual cycles and fertility in patients with polycystic ovarian syndrome (pcos) due to the link with Insulin elevations. However, in the last 5 years, studies have not demonstrated metformin as an improvment of fertility in pcos patients and is only indicated if the patient has prediabetes or diabetes.
